EV Charging Cost in India (2026)

In India, electricity rates vary by state and usage.


Home Charging Cost

  • ₹6 – ₹10 per unit (kWh)

  • Most economical option


Public Charging Cost

  • ₹12 – ₹25 per unit

  • Higher due to infrastructure and service charges

Example Calculation:

  • Battery size: 40 kWh

  • Electricity cost: ₹8/unit

Full charge cost = ₹320


EV Cost Per Km in India


EVs are significantly cheaper to run than petrol cars.

Example:

  • Battery: 40 kWh

  • Range: 300 km

Cost per km = ₹320 ÷ 300 = ~₹1.1/km

Comparison:

  • EV: ₹1–₹2/km

  • Petrol car: ₹7–₹10/km

Is EV Charging Cheaper Than Petrol or Diesel?

Yes, EV charging is significantly cheaper.

Monthly Comparison:

  • Petrol car (1,000 km): ₹7,000 – ₹10,000

  • EV (1,000 km): ₹1,000 – ₹2,000

This results in massive long-term savings.

FAQs


What is the average EV charging cost in India?

It ranges from ₹300 to ₹800 for a full charge depending on battery size and electricity rates.


Is home charging cheaper than public charging?

Yes, home charging is significantly cheaper and more convenient.


What is the cost per km for EVs in India?

Around ₹1 to ₹2 per km, much lower than petrol or diesel vehicles.


Can I charge my EV using solar panels?

Yes, rooftop solar can power EV charging and reduce costs significantly.


Do public charging stations cost more?

Yes, they are typically 2–3 times more expensive than home charging.
